Transaction 58ef75df4a5bdfa3746bcc44ee8c732969b589ba20529784d4c60fc724394af9

1 Input
2 Outputs
  • 58ef75df4a5bdfa3746bcc44ee8c732969b589ba20529784d4c60fc724394af9:0
  • value  482722
    address  3LUeNzavEga1z8jZJJxs3VWY6eB4oxcbPN
  • 58ef75df4a5bdfa3746bcc44ee8c732969b589ba20529784d4c60fc724394af9:1
  • value  51651466
    address  3EfPJKcu3y8F4GAc82jUzmNM8MEUdp5KHm